I purchased Microsoft office home and student 2007 on line and it gave me a
product key...but when i go into the trial and convert and put in the product
key it is telling me that it is wrong. It isn't wrong and I just spent money
for this product that I can't or don't know how to access.

I'm going to take a guess that you're trying to use the product key to
activate Outlook...

....Outlook isn't part of the Home and Student Edition 2007. Try the product
key in Word, Excel, PowerPoint or OneNote.

OK, but have you INSTALLED it? You need to uninstall the trial version you
already have, (control panel-Add/remove programs) and then find the file you
downloaded and double-click on it to start the installation process. You
will be asked for the product key that you were sent when you downloaded the
file at some point in this process.
